Apprentice Academy: Knights: The Unofficial Guide to the Heroic Arts

Rate this book
Congratulations on your acceptance to the Apprentice Academy, one of the world’s finest institutions for knightly education. Your course of study here will prepare you for a career as a knight, samurai, Viking, or really any type of sword-swinging warrior. Swinging a sword is inherently dangerous, but this guide will help you complete your education while minimizing the twin risks of 1. getting maimed and 2. working too hard.

Learn how
• Fight people!
• Fight dragons!
• Fight monsters!
• Fight everything else!
• Die honorably!
• And more!

Please follow all instructions carefully. If you go off on your own and try something silly, and then get your head chopped off of your body bitten in two, don’t start drafting a letter of complaint. You had fair warning.
